The three key items in this outfit are the black jumpsuit*, the red floral blazer* and the bronze slider sandals*, all by JD Williams. I’ve had my eye on the jumpsuit for AGES, despite its “not me” colour, but somehow I knew I could still style it the NDAL way.
A big dollop of colour, some great accessories and BAM! – an outfit fit for a summer holiday. Depending on how hot your destination is, the jersey fabric is perfect for cooler evenings. The wide legs allow some much-needed ventilation to take effect. The wrapover top is especially flattering to bigger boobies (like mine) and the waist is stretchy – perfect for a tapas-induced food baby.
If you’re like me and want a little more modesty, add a camisole underneath (here’s a pink with black lace and a blue with black lace version). You could even wear the jumpsuit straight over the top of your swimsuit or bikini. The red floral blazer* is lightweight and adds that colour I always desperately need/want with any outfit, even if I’m wearing black.
The accessories really finish off this outfit: a Panama hat (you ALWAYS want a hat in the summer to fend off those pesky sunrays), a white tote bag (avoid black bags with black outfits at ALL costs, there’s nothing duller…), statement earrings and a deep red belt to ‘neaten’ the elasticated waist of the jumpsuit.
The bronze slider sandals* are yet another version of my new favourite sandal style for summer – flat, chunky and comfy. Bronze couldn’t be more apt for a summer holiday, could it…?

I don’t think your weight has anything to do with it, Karen – if you look at my plus size bloggers post I published the other week https://www.notdressedaslamb.com/2019/06/14-plus-size-fashion-bloggers-you-should-know.html you’ll see that lots of them wear jumpsuits and look amazing! It’s just about getting the one that suits your shape rather than your size – and of course one that fits your personality (whether you’re a florals, plain or patterned girl for example, and whether you want a simple design or a fussier style with belts, buttons, pockets etc.)
My best advice is to order several different shapes and colours and get someone to photograph you (don’t do mirror selfies), then study the photos. You’ll soon see what one you like the best…! Remember if you like it, GO FOR IT. Don’t get hung up on whether you “should” be wearing it or not.
